OK! so now you have a good feel good feel. Now lets make it better! 
When you install the Performance Transformer Pull Rod all you will really have to do is make small adjustments, if any, to make the handling better.
 
1. Make sure you go over all the bolts to make sure your bike doesn't fall apart in the air. 
2. Start with the recommended rider sag setting, but adjust more or less pre load on the spring to find your feel.
3. Raise and lower the fork tubes. (changing the fork tube height will give you a lot of feed back ) Don't be afraid!
"This is fun so make sure you smile and don't get frustrated LOL!"
3. Its always good to start at the recommended compression and rebound setting. 
*Dont make adjustment to every clicker that you have all at once before you ride. You want to know what did what, so adjust one adjustment at a time so you know what adjustment did what.
*Make huge adjustment if you don't feel anything, that way the feel will smack you right in your senses and you will remember it better.   
4. WRITE IT DOWN
* This is so important WRITE IT DOWN and put it in your owners manual or tool box for the next race or test day.
